DIY Epoxy Garage Floor Installation Made Easy
Give your garage floor a stunning look with a DIY epoxy coating! It's easier than you think to achieve a durable and impressive-looking finish. With the proper tools and materials, you can transform your garage floor in just a few weekend.
First, carefully prepare your existing floor surface. Remove any dirt, debris, or oil stains with a heavy-duty cleaner. Once the floor is dry, apply a primer to ensure proper adhesion for the epoxy coating.
Next, combine your epoxy resin according to the manufacturer's instructions. Pour the epoxy evenly across the floor using a paintbrush. Work in chunks to avoid bubbles. For a multi-colored effect, you can incorporate different pigments of epoxy or create unique patterns.
Finally, let the epoxy harden completely according to the manufacturer's recommendations. Once it's cured, you can appreciate your newly beautiful garage floor!
Remember to always utilize appropriate safety gear, such as gloves and eye protection, when working with epoxy.

Transform Your Garage Flooring: A Step-by-Step Guide
Ready to enhance the look and durability of your garage floor? Epoxy flooring is a fantastic choice, offering a stylish finish that's also incredibly tough. This step-by-step guide will walk you through the process, helping you to achieve a professional-looking result right in your own garage.
- {Firstly|First|, we'll prepare the surface. This involves thoroughly scrubbing the floor to get rid of any dirt, grease, or loose particles.
- {Next|Then|, you'll need to put down a primer to ensure a strong bond between the epoxy and concrete.
- After the primer is cured, it's time to mix your epoxy according to the manufacturer's instructions.
- Apply the epoxy evenly onto the floor using a roller or squeegee.
- Finally, allow the epoxy to cure completely, which usually takes 24-72 hours.

Epoxy Garage Floor Care: A Guide to Pristine
Keeping your epoxy garage floor looking its best is essential for both aesthetics and protection. Regular maintenance guarantees a durable, attractive finish that withstands the wear and tear of daily use. To maintain the pristine condition of your epoxy floor, you should implement a few simple steps.
First, vacuum the floor regularly to remove dirt, debris, and grit. Next, consider using a specialized cleaner designed for epoxy floors. Avoid harsh chemicals or abrasive scrubbers, which can damage the surface.
Finally, seal your floor every several of years to protect it from stains and scratches. By following these easy maintenance tips, you can extend the life and beauty of your epoxy garage floor for years to come.
